Sometimes, unit tests with mocked services just aren't enough. We'd like to be able to run repeatable tests against the real thing without fear of corrupting data or affecting others.
With Testcontainers, there is no need for mocks or complicated environment configurations. We can define our target environment in code and then run our tests against ephemeral containers. Java developers have had this ability for several years, but now Go developers have this similar ability!
Enjoy the discussion and demonstration of this open-source project created by the folks at AtomicJar, recently acquired by Docker.
Paul is a CNCF Ambassador, GoBridge Ambassador, and a Developer Advocate at Grafana Labs. In this role, he encourages developers and testers alike to "shift left," bringing reliability testing earlier in the software development process.
